#040886 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#040886 is composed of 1.6% red, 3.1%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97% cyan, 94%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 238.2 degrees, a saturation of 94.2% and a lightness of 27.1%. #040886 color hex could be obtained by blending #0810ff with #00000d.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#040886 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#040886 has RGB values of R:4, G:8, B:134 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 264326.
